Quick and Dirty Apricot Emulator, QDAE in short is an Apricot F1 and Apricot Xi emulator for Windows, Linux and Mac OS X.

Quote:
QDAE is a Quick and Dirty Apricot Emulator for Linux, Windows and MacOS X. This version emulates the Apricot F1 and the Apricot Xi; it may support other F-series and PC-series Apricots as well.

Features wholly or partly implemented are:

* Emulates the 8086 processor (using the CPU emulation from GDE.
* Emulates the infrared keyboard and mouse well enough to boot DOS and use GEM.
* Emulates the screen (using SDL).
* Emulates the floppy drives (using LibDsk).
* Emulates the support chipset (Z80-CTC, Z80-SIO, i8089, i8253, i8259) well enough to boot.

Features not implemented are:

* The Winchester disk (hard drive).
* Serial and parallel ports.
